Plant growth and coverage
- Compact, sturdy habit; ideal for containers and small beds
- Height: 55–64 cm (22–25 in)
- Spread: 40–50 cm (16–20 in)
- Spacing: 35–45 cm (14–18 in) in-row; 60–75 cm (24–30 in) between rows; 3–5 gal container per plant
- Full sun; about 65 days to harvest
